Study programme | Français | ||
Software Evolution | |||
Activité d'apprentissage à la Faculty of Science |
Code | Lecturer(s) | Associate Lecturer(s) | Subsitute Lecturer(s) et other(s) |
---|---|---|---|
S-INFO-029 |
|
Language of instruction | Language of assessment | HT(*) | HTPE(*) | HTPS(*) | HR(*) | HD(*) | Term |
---|---|---|---|---|---|---|---|
Anglais | Français | 30 | 15 | 15 | 0 | 0 | Q2 |
Content of Learning Activity
See the contents of the corresponding UE.
Required Learning Resources/Tools
The required learning resources and tools are available on Moodle, the online e-learning platform of the university.
Recommended Learning Resources/Tools
The recommended learning resources and tools are available on Moodle, the online e-learning platform of the university.
Other Recommended Reading
Tom Mens, Alexander Serebrenik, Anthony Cleve (editors). Evolving Software Systems. Springer, 2014
Tom Mens and Serge Demeyer (editors). Software Evolution, Springer, 2008
Nazim H. Madhavji and Juan F. Ramil and Dewayne E. Perry (editors). Software Evolution and Feedback: Theory and Practice, Wiley, 2006. ISBN 0-470-87180-6
Penny A. Grubb and Armstrong A. Takang. Software Maintenance: Concepts and Practice (2nd edition), World Scientific Pub Co, 2003. ISBN 981-238425-1
Hongji Yang and Martin Ward. Succesful Evolution of Software Systems, Artech House, 2003. ISBN 158-053349-3
Thomas M. Pigoski. Practical Software Maintenance: Best Practices for Managing your Software Investment, John Wiley and Sons, 1997. ISBN 0-471-17001-1
Meir M. Lehman and L. A. Belady. Program Evolution: Processes of Software Change, Academic Press, 1985. ISBN 0-12-442441-4
Mode of delivery
Type of Teaching Activity/Activities
Evaluations
The assessment methods of the Learning Activity (AA) are specified in the course description of the corresponding Educational Component (UE)